MBRB735 Equivalent & Substitute Parts
Part Overview
The MBRB735 is a Schottky rectifier diode manufactured by Vishay General Semiconductor - Diodes Division, rated for 35 V DC reverse voltage and 7.5 A average rectified current in a surface mount TO-263AB (D2PAK) package. This component is classified as obsolete, making identification of equivalent substitute parts necessary for ongoing design support and procurement continuity. The part operates across a junction temperature range of -65°C to 150°C and exhibits fast recovery characteristics suitable for high-frequency rectification applications.

Key Parameters
| Parameter | Value | Unit |
|---|---|---|
| Voltage - DC Reverse (Vr) (Max) | 35 | V |
| Current - Average Rectified (Io) | 7.5 | A |
| Voltage - Forward (Vf) (Max) @ If | 840 mV @ 15 A | mV @ A |
| Speed | Fast Recovery ≤ 500ns, > 200mA (Io) | ns |
| Current - Reverse Leakage @ Vr | 100 µA @ 35 V | µA @ V |
| Mounting Type | Surface Mount | — |
| Package / Case | TO-263-3, D2PAK (2 Leads + Tab) | — |
| Operating Temperature - Junction | -65 to 150 | °C |
| Technology | Schottky | — |
| RoHS Status | RoHS non-compliant | — |
Substitute Part Grouping Explanation
Substitution of the MBRB735 is based on electrical and mechanical parameter compatibility within the Schottky rectifier diode category. The primary substitution criteria are:
Electrical Compatibility:
- Current rating: Minimum 7.5 A average rectified current (Io)
- Voltage rating: Minimum 35 V DC reverse voltage (Vr)
- Forward voltage: Maximum 840 mV @ 15 A
- Recovery speed: Fast recovery ≤ 500ns, > 200mA (Io)
- Reverse leakage: Maximum 100 µA at rated voltage
Mechanical Compatibility:
- Package type: TO-263-3 / D2PAK (2 Leads + Tab)
- Mounting type: Surface Mount
The STPS745G-TR meets or exceeds all electrical parameters of the MBRB735 while maintaining identical mechanical compatibility. The substitute part provides higher voltage rating (45 V vs. 35 V) and extended maximum junction temperature (175°C vs. 150°C), enabling direct substitution in applications requiring the MBRB735.
Parameter Comparison
| Parameter | MBRB735 (Vishay) | STPS745G-TR (STMicroelectronics) | Compatibility |
|---|---|---|---|
| Voltage - DC Reverse (Vr) (Max) | 35 V | 45 V | Compatible (higher rating) |
| Current - Average Rectified (Io) | 7.5 A | 7.5 A | Identical |
| Voltage - Forward (Vf) (Max) @ If | 840 mV @ 15 A | 840 mV @ 15 A | Identical |
| Speed | Fast Recovery ≤ 500ns, > 200mA (Io) | Fast Recovery ≤ 500ns, > 200mA (Io) | Identical |
| Current - Reverse Leakage @ Vr | 100 µA @ 35 V | 100 µA @ 45 V | Compatible |
| Mounting Type | Surface Mount | Surface Mount | Identical |
| Package / Case | TO-263-3, D2PAK | TO-263-3, D2PAK | Identical |
| Operating Temperature - Junction (Max) | 150°C | 175°C | Compatible (higher rating) |
| Technology | Schottky | Schottky | Identical |
| Product Status | Obsolete | Active | Substitute is active |
| RoHS Status | RoHS non-compliant | ROHS3 Compliant | Substitute offers compliance |
Engineering Selection Recommendations
The STPS745G-TR is the direct substitute for the obsolete MBRB735. Selection is based on the following engineering factors:
Product Status: The MBRB735 is classified as obsolete, while the STPS745G-TR maintains active product status with confirmed inventory availability (16,100 pcs in stock). This ensures long-term procurement viability and supply chain continuity.
Regulatory Compliance: The STPS745G-TR is ROHS3 compliant, whereas the MBRB735 is RoHS non-compliant. For applications subject to RoHS directives or customer compliance requirements, the STPS745G-TR provides regulatory alignment.
Electrical Performance: The STPS745G-TR exceeds the MBRB735 specifications in voltage rating (45 V vs. 35 V) and maximum junction temperature (175°C vs. 150°C). These higher ratings provide design margin and thermal headroom without compromising any electrical characteristics. Forward voltage, reverse leakage, recovery speed, and current rating are identical.
Mechanical Compatibility: Both parts utilize identical TO-263-3 D2PAK surface mount packaging, enabling direct PCB footprint compatibility without layout modifications.
Certification: Both parts carry identical REACH and ECCN classifications (REACH Unaffected, EAR99), with moisture sensitivity level MSL 1 (Unlimited).
Frequently Asked Questions (FAQ)
Q: Can the STPS745G-TR directly replace the MBRB735 on existing PCBs?
A: Yes. Both components use identical TO-263-3 D2PAK surface mount packaging with the same pinout and footprint. No PCB modifications are required.
Q: What is the primary reason for substitution?
A: The MBRB735 is obsolete. The STPS745G-TR is an active product with equivalent electrical performance and superior specifications, ensuring design continuity and procurement availability.
Q: Are the electrical characteristics identical between these parts?
A: The forward voltage (840 mV @ 15 A), average rectified current (7.5 A), recovery speed (≤ 500ns), and reverse leakage (100 µA) are identical. The STPS745G-TR provides higher voltage rating (45 V vs. 35 V) and extended temperature range (175°C vs. 150°C).
Q: Does the higher voltage rating of the STPS745G-TR affect circuit operation?
A: No. A higher voltage rating does not degrade performance in applications designed for 35 V operation. The substitute part operates safely within the original design specifications while providing additional voltage margin.
Q: What is the difference in RoHS compliance?
A: The MBRB735 is RoHS non-compliant. The STPS745G-TR is ROHS3 compliant, meeting current environmental and regulatory standards for electronic components.
Q: Are there any thermal performance differences?
A: The STPS745G-TR supports a maximum junction temperature of 175°C compared to 150°C for the MBRB735. This provides 25°C additional thermal headroom in high-temperature applications.
Q: Is the packaging identical?
A: Yes. Both parts are supplied in TO-263-3 D2PAK (2 Leads + Tab) surface mount packages. The STPS745G-TR is supplied in Tape & Reel (TR) packaging format.
Q: Can I use the STPS745G-TR in reverse polarity applications?
A: No. Schottky rectifier diodes are polarized components. The STPS745G-TR must be oriented with correct polarity matching the original MBRB735 installation.
Q: What is the reverse leakage current specification for the STPS745G-TR?
A: The STPS745G-TR specifies 100 µA maximum reverse leakage at 45 V, which is equivalent to the MBRB735 specification of 100 µA at 35 V.
